To deliver true business strategy and innovation it is essential that research and insight teams work effectively with other business areas whether that be the marketing team, CSR department, finance teams, board directors, customer teams and many many more. Working effectively with others, enables research, insight and intelligence to be leveraged throughout an organisation, integrated and communicated to others, informing strategic business direction.

Knowledge, Skills and Attitudes (Supply-side researchers)

1. Communicate purposes and objectives to team members and other internal departments

2. Involve and effectively manage research teams and/or subcontractors

3. Develop personal effectiveness skills to ensure impact across the business

4. Encourage, steer and support other teams in meeting business objectives

5. Create a climate of trust and mutual respect, successfully collaborating with other departments and stakeholders
